What are alternative sources of energy? Well basically an alternative energy source is anything other than the conventional or traditional sources of energy. However in this case is a bit of the reverse. For example, here I'm going to be talking about using wood pellets and biomass pellets as the alternative source of energy to oil, gas and coal. However, we obviously used wood and sources of biomass as energy before we ever used oil, gas or coal. The reasons we are now moving back to used wood and biomass energy is simple. Firstly wood and biomass energy is a renewable source of energy, which basically means we can replace it with more wood and biomass, unlike oil, gas and coal.

Well strictly speaking, we can replace oil, gas and coal as they are made from natural resources, the issue is time. Oil, gas and coal were formed from thousands and millions of years of compression, the problem is we consume these resources at a rate which massively exceeds the rate this natural process takes place to repeat the process. However, if we can used certain wood and biomass resources effectively, we can replace these resources within the life cycle of their consumption. One of the best materials for this is actually hemp. Hemp has a 3 month growing cycle from seed to harvest, and can produce fuel which burns in a very similar fashion to wood. However, there is no wood species which has a 3 month growing cycle. Hence the advantages of hemp.

So we know have covered the benefits of wood and biomass materials such as hemp, but where do pellets come in and pellet stoves. Well, in its raw form biomass has different moisture content, different densities, is bulky and generally hard to deal with and burn properly. By processing wood and biomass materials such as hemp into fuel pellets we are producing a uniform fuel, which can be burnt highly efficiently in automated pellet stoves and boilers. However, the pellet stove and boiler market has been too dependant on wood pellets, and has neglected the biomass fuel pellet market. Therefore too many pellet stoves can only burn premium grade wood pellets. However there are more fuel flexible pellet stoves and pellet boilers which can burn fuel pellets such as hemp pellets, you just need to know what to look for and that is what this website is about.
